Dating Confidence Reset
Start by clarifying what you want from Mingle2 before you swipe or message. List the top two things that matter to you—whether it’s casual conversation, meeting new people, or exploring a relationship—and use those priorities to guide who you invest time in. Keeping your aims simple makes choices easier and reduces second-guessing.
Set realistic expectations for response and pace. Online dating is a slow filter, not a fast pipeline. Expect some matches not to reply and some conversations to fizzle; that doesn’t reflect your worth. Give promising conversations space to develop over a few messages or one call before deciding whether to continue.
Adopt a steady, numbers-light mindset: treat outreach as opportunities to learn about others, not as points in a game. Limit how many new conversations you start at once so you can actually read profiles, remember details, and respond thoughtfully. Quality attention feels better to give and receive than scattershot messaging.
Use small milestones to notice progress. Celebrate when you craft a clearer message, get a thoughtful reply, or move from chat to a voice call. These steps show momentum even when outcomes are uncertain, and they rebuild confidence more reliably than waiting for a single big success.
Protect your time and self-respect by testing compatibility early. Ask a few practical questions that matter to you—values, lifestyle, dealbreakers—within the first few exchanges. If answers don’t align, it’s okay to politely step back. Saying no kindly saves you energy for matches that fit your priorities.
Finally, keep self-care part of the process. Log off when you feel drained, talk to friends about frustrating experiences, and do activities that remind you who you are outside dating. Returning refreshed makes your conversations clearer, calmer, and more likely to attract people who appreciate the real you.
